Reducing Friction Across the Customer Journey
Friction kills conversion. Unclear messaging, confusing layouts, and unnecessary steps cause prospects to hesitate or leave.
We identify and remove friction across:
- landing pages
- lead capture forms
- navigation and page flow
- content structure
- calls to action
By simplifying paths and clarifying next steps, we increase completion rates and lead quality.
UX That Pre-Handles Objections
Sales objections often start long before a sales call. UX plays a critical role in answering questions, building credibility, and reducing doubt.
We design experiences that:
- clearly communicate value propositions
- reinforce trust with proof and credibility signals
- set expectations early
- address common concerns proactively
This prepares prospects for sales conversations and reduces resistance later in the funnel.

Data-Driven UX Optimization
UX improvements are driven by data, not assumptions. We analyze user behavior to understand where prospects hesitate, abandon, or convert.
We evaluate:
- click paths and engagement
- conversion drop-off points
- form completion rates
- time to action
Insights are used to continuously refine and improve performance.
